Tech stack
The core challenge: maintain a continuously-verified global index of every place on Earth as reality changes fast. That means multi-source ingestion at scale, entity resolution across conflicting signals, confidence and freshness scoring, and an API designed for AI agents. It's a data + ML + systems problem.
Python, FastAPI · ML/AI: custom models, LLM APIs (OpenAI, Gemini, Anthropic) · PostgreSQL, PostGIS, DynamoDB · AWS (EKS, CloudWatch), Docker, Redis
